Under-18s report: Chelsea 13 Brighton 0

Charlie Brown bagged four despite only coming off the bench for the final half-hour, while Martell Taylor-Crossdale and Luke McCormick netted hat-tricks of their own. Conor Gallagher had opened the scoring after 15 minutes, while Cole Dasilva and Harvey St Clair also found the back of the net on an incredible morning for our youngsters.
